Stephen Colbert new show
Definition
A reference to American comedian and television host Stephen Colbert's recent guest appearance on the CBS crime comedy series 'Elsbeth,' where he portrays the host of a fictional late-night talk show called 'Way Late with Scotty Bristol.'
Informal phrase alluding to speculation or news around Stephen Colbert's next project following the announced replacement of 'The Late Show with Stephen Colbert' by Byron Allen's 'Comics Unleashed' on CBS.
